1. 简介
Windows 7和Linux是当前两大主流操作系统之一。Windows 7以其用户友好的界面和广泛的软件兼容性而闻名,而Linux则以其卓越的稳定性和安全性受到许多开发者和技术爱好者的青睐。在实际应用中,Windows 7和Linux的联合使用可以为用户提供更为全面的体验和更高的灵活性。
2. Windows 7与Linux的优势
2.1 Windows 7的优势
作为一个广泛应用的操作系统,Windows 7具有许多优势。首先,它拥有用户友好的界面,使得用户可以轻松上手并快速完成操作。其次,Windows 7有着丰富的软件支持,几乎可以找到满足各种需求的应用程序。此外,Windows 7的硬件兼容性也非常出色,几乎支持市面上所有的硬件设备。
2.2 Linux的优势
相对于Windows 7,Linux有着不同的优势。首先,Linux是一个开源系统,使得用户可以自由访问、修改和共享其源代码。这给予了开发者们更大的自由度,可以根据需求进行个性化的定制。其次,Linux以其卓越的稳定性和安全性而著名,很少会出现蓝屏或崩溃的情况。此外,Linux还具有出色的多任务处理能力和服务器性能,被广泛应用于服务器领域。
3. Windows 7与Linux的联合使用方式
3.1 双系统安装
在联合使用Windows 7和Linux时,一种常见的方式是在同一台计算机上安装双系统。用户可以通过对硬盘进行分区,将Windows 7和Linux分别装在不同的分区上。这样,用户可以根据具体需求选择启动Windows 7或Linux,实现两个操作系统的灵活切换。
// 操作系统选择菜单
menuentry "Windows 7" {
set root=(hd0,1)
chainloader +1
}
menuentry "Ubuntu" {
set root=(hd0,2)
linux /boot/vmlinuz root=/dev/sda2
initrd /boot/initrd.img
}
在双系统安装中,用户可以根据自己的需求选择Linux的发行版,如Ubuntu、Fedora或Debian等。不同发行版各有特色,用户可以根据自己的喜好和使用需求进行选择。
3.2 虚拟机安装
另一种联合使用的方式是通过虚拟机安装Linux。用户可以在Windows 7上安装虚拟机软件(如VMware Workstation、VirtualBox等),然后在虚拟机中安装Linux系统。这种方式可以避免对硬盘进行分区,同时也可以在Windows 7和Linux之间快速切换。
// 虚拟机中安装Linux
$ sudo apt-get install virtualbox
$ vboxmanage createvm --name "Linux" --ostype Ubuntu
$ vboxmanage storagectl "Linux" --name "IDE Controller" --add ide
$ vboxmanage storageattach "Linux" --storagectl "IDE Controller" --port 0 --device 0 --type hdd --medium linux.img
$ vboxmanage storageattach "Linux" --storagectl "IDE Controller" --port 1 --device 0 --type dvddrive --medium linux.iso
通过虚拟机安装Linux,用户可以同时运行Windows 7和Linux,方便进行开发、测试等工作。同时,虚拟机还可以进行快照和克隆等操作,方便用户管理和备份虚拟机环境。
4. 联合使用的好处
4.1 兼顾用户友好性和稳定性
联合使用Windows 7和Linux可以兼顾用户友好性和稳定性。用户可以在Windows 7上进行常规办公、娱乐等操作,而在需要更高稳定性和安全性的场景下,可以切换到Linux进行开发、服务器管理等工作。
4.2 软件兼容性与自由度的平衡
Windows 7拥有广泛的软件兼容性,几乎可以找到满足各种需求的应用程序。而Linux则可以通过开源社区的支持,定制满足特定需求的软件或操作系统。联合使用Windows 7和Linux,用户可以在兼顾软件兼容性的同时,也能享受到自由度带来的定制化体验。
4.3 提高学习和开发效率
对于开发者和技术爱好者而言,联合使用Windows 7和Linux可以提高学习和开发效率。Windows 7提供了广泛的开发环境和工具,而Linux则提供了强大的命令行和服务器管理能力。通过联合使用,用户可以充分利用两个操作系统的优势,更高效地进行开发和学习。
5. 结论
Windows 7和Linux是两个各有优势的操作系统,联合使用可以充分发挥两者的长处。通过双系统安装或虚拟机安装的方式,用户可以灵活切换操作系统,兼顾用户友好性和稳定性。在实际应用中,联合使用Windows 7和Linux可以提高用户的体验和灵活性,同时也可以提高学习和开发效率。